On the 13th, Coway announced that it signed a business agreement with the Ministry of Environment at the ‘2024 Indoor Environment Improvement Business Agreement Ceremony for Vulnerable Groups’ held at the Korea Environmental Industry & Technology Institute on the 12th, marking its seventh consecutive year participating in the environmental disease prevention project.


The environmental disease prevention project for vulnerable groups is a welfare initiative jointly conducted by the Ministry of Environment, the Korea Environmental Industry & Technology Institute, and private companies, aimed at improving indoor environments for socially sensitive groups who are easily exposed to environmental hazards. Since 2018, Coway has annually signed a business agreement with the Ministry of Environment to support healthy indoor environments for socially vulnerable groups. The company provides air purifiers to households in need of indoor air quality improvement and offers free management services such as filter replacement for two years.


In recognition of these contributions, Coway received a commendation from the Minister of Environment at the ceremony.


In addition, Coway has contributed to improving community water welfare since 2015 through projects such as the Safe Groundwater Support Project for residents in groundwater-vulnerable areas in cooperation with the Ministry of Environment.



A Coway representative stated, “We plan to continue our support and maintain ongoing interest in marginalized neighbors and vulnerable groups so that all members of our society can enjoy the value of safe and clean water and air and live in a healthy environment.”
